StringCollection.IList.IndexOf(Object) Metode
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Mencari yang ditentukan Object dan mengembalikan indeks berbasis nol dari kemunculan pertama dalam seluruh StringCollection.
virtual int System.Collections.IList.IndexOf(System::Object ^ value) = System::Collections::IList::IndexOf;
int IList.IndexOf (object value);
int IList.IndexOf (object? value);
abstract member System.Collections.IList.IndexOf : obj -> int
override this.System.Collections.IList.IndexOf : obj -> int
Function IndexOf (value As Object) As Integer Implements IList.IndexOf
Parameter
- value
- Object
Object untuk menemukan di StringCollection. Nilainya bisa .null
Mengembalikan
Indeks berbasis nol dari kemunculan pertama dari value
seluruh StringCollection, jika ditemukan; jika tidak, -1.
Penerapan
Keterangan
StringCollection dicari maju mulai dari elemen pertama dan berakhir pada elemen terakhir.
Metode ini menentukan kesetaraan dengan memanggil Object.Equals.
Metode ini melakukan pencarian linier; oleh karena itu, metode ini adalah operasi O(n
), di mana n
adalah Count.
Dimulai dengan .NET Framework 2.0, metode ini menggunakan objek Equals dan CompareTo metode item
koleksi untuk menentukan apakah item ada. Dalam versi .NET Framework sebelumnya, penentuan ini dibuat dengan menggunakan Equals metode item
dan CompareTo parameter pada objek dalam koleksi.